  • George Town: Nestled on the banks of the Tamar River, George Town serves as a charming gateway to Tasmania's stunning north-east. The George Town Watch House is a key historical landmark within the suburb. Visitors flock to George Town for its outdoor adventures and breathtaking scenery, with highlights including beautiful beaches and expansive national parks. Engage in activities such as water sports, or enjoy a round of golf at the local courses. Whether you’re exploring the quaint streets or taking in the coastal views, George Town offers a delightful mix of relaxation and adventure.
  • Low Head: Located a mere 3.2km from George Town, Low Head is a picturesque coastal suburb known for its stunning natural beauty. This area is home to the iconic historic lighthouse, which provides a glimpse into the region's maritime history. Travellers are drawn to Low Head for outdoor activities and scenic views, with opportunities for golfing and enjoying the pristine beaches. The atmosphere is serene, making it a perfect spot for a peaceful getaway while still being close to the vibrant experiences of George Town.
  • Kelso: Just 3.2km away from the George Town Watch House, Kelso is a quaint suburb that offers a mix of stunning landscapes and local charm. The area is popular among outdoor enthusiasts, with its beautiful beaches and striking canyon gorge inviting exploration. While visitor numbers are moderately seasonal, Kelso maintains a relaxed vibe year-round. Enjoy leisurely walks through the neighbourhood or partake in various outdoor adventures, making it a perfect stop for those looking to immerse themselves in Tasmania's natural beauty.

The nearest major airports for your trip to George Town Watch House

To visit George Town Watch House, the nearest major airports are Launceston (LST), located 57.9km away, and Devonport (DPO), situated 33.8km away. Near Launceston, you can find several quality accommodations such as the 4.5-star Hotel Grand Chancellor, 12.9km from the airport, and Peppers Silo Hotel, 14.5km away. Devonport offers options like the 4.5-star Tranquilles Bed and Breakfast, just 8.0km from the airport. For those flying into Burnie (BWT), 512.9km from George Town, Coastal Pods Wynyard is a 4.5-star hotel located only 966m from the airport. Each airport provides various transportation services to these hotels.

What can I see and do near George Town Watch House?

You'll want to browse the exhibits at Low Head Pilot Station Maritime Museum and Bass & Flinders Centre. Sights like Low Head Lighthouse and George Town Memorial Hall highlight some of the local culture. Spend some time wandering around Elizabeth Park, Redbill Point Conservation Area and George Town Conservation Area.
